1
WHAT METHYLDOPA TABLETS ARE AND WHAT
THEY ARE USED FOR
Methyldopa belongs to a group of medicines called
antihypertensives, which lower blood pressure.
Methyldopa tablets are used to treat high blood
pressure (hypertension).

                                SUMMARY OF PRODUCT CHARACTERISTICS
1
NAME OF THE MEDICINAL PRODUCT
METHYLDOPA TABLETS BP 125mg
2
QUALITATIVE AND QUANTITATIVE COMPOSITION
Each tablet contains: Methyldopa PhEur equivalent to anhydrous
methyldopa
125mg.
Excipient with known effect: Each tablet contains 0.002mg of Sunset
yellow
(E110).
For the full list of excipients, see section 6.1.
3
PHARMACEUTICAL FORM
Yellow film-coated tablets.
Yellow, circular, biconvex film-coated tablets, impressed “C” on
one face and
the identifying letters “MA” on the reverse.
4.
CLINICAL PARTICULARS
4.1
THERAPEUTIC INDICATIONS
1) Treatment of hypertension.
4.2
POSOLOGY AND METHOD OF ADMINISTRATION
_POSOLOGY _
Since methyldopa is largely excreted by the kidneys, patients with
impaired renal function may respond to comparatively low doses.
Withdrawal of methyldopa which is followed by return of hypertension,
usually within 48 hours, is not complicated generally by an overshoot
of
blood pressure.
Therapy with methyldopa may be initiated in most patients already on
treatment with other antihypertensive agents by terminating these
antihypertensive medications gradually if required (see manufacturers
recommendations on stopping these drugs). Following such previous
antihypertensive therapy, methyldopa should be limited to an initial
dose
of not more than 500mg daily and increased as required at intervals of
not less than two days.
A thiazide may be added at any time during methyldopa therapy and is
recommended if therapy has not been started with a thiazide or if
effective control of blood pressure cannot be maintained on 2g of
methyldopa daily.
Methyldopa may also be used concomitantly with the combination of
amiloride hydrochloride and hydrochlorothiazide or beta-blocking
agents, such as timolol maleate.
When methyldopa is given to patients on other antihypertensives the
dose of these agents may need to be adjusted to effect a smooth
transition.
